About Valentin Brumberg

Valentin Brumberg is a scholar working on Genetics, Pulmonary and Respiratory Medicine, Biomaterials, Biomedical Engineering and Surgery, having authored 8 papers that have together received 363 indexed citations. Recurring topics across this work include Mesenchymal stem cell research (4 papers), Electrospun Nanofibers in Biomedical Applications (2 papers), Oral health in cancer treatment (2 papers), Cancer Cells and Metastasis (1 paper), Bone Tissue Engineering Materials (1 paper), Infectious Aortic and Vascular Conditions (1 paper), Wound Healing and Treatments (1 paper) and 3D Printing in Biomedical Research (1 paper). The work is most often cited by research in Rehabilitation (240 citations), Molecular Medicine (66 citations), Biomaterials (173 citations), Occupational Therapy (18 citations) and Genetics (33 citations). Valentin Brumberg has collaborated with scholars based in Russia, Sweden and France. Frequent co-authors include Т. А. Астрелина, T. F. Malivanova, А.С. Самойлов, Elena Lomonosova, Sergey Rodin, Marc Benderitter, Pavlov Ka, Zahra Heydari, Svetlana Kotova and Massoud Vosough. Their work appears in journals such as Biomedicines, Cells, PLoS ONE, International Journal of Bioprinting and Voprosy ginekologii akušerstva i perinatologii.
